Semi-invariants of Quivers and Saturation of Littlewood-Richardson Coefficients

Abstract

dc:description.abstract

Using Schofield semi-invariants, and showing a correspondence between weight spaces of semi-invariant rings for a special class of quivers, and the Littlewood-Richardson coefficients, we show that the space of Littlewood-Richardson numbers is saturated, i.e. if cN \lambda, N μN \nu \neq 0 then c\lambda, μ\nu \neq 0, by showing that weights σ \in \Sigma(Q, β) are saturated.
